Bug 477583 - Default screenshot/cast name should be localisable
Summary: Default screenshot/cast name should be localisable
Status: RESOLVED FIXED
Alias: None
Product: Spectacle
Classification: Applications
Component: General (show other bugs)
Version: git-master
Platform: Other Other
: NOR normal
Target Milestone: ---
Assignee: Noah Davis
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2023-11-26 20:59 UTC by Emir SARI
Modified: 2023-11-28 20:39 UTC (History)
1 user (show)

See Also:
Latest Commit:
Version Fixed In:
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Emir SARI 2023-11-26 20:59:43 UTC
Currently it is hardcoded to "Screenshot_date_time". This needs to be localised as in other operating systems.

While we're at it, we could also improve the date/time formatting with dashes and colons. It is not very easily readable right now.
Comment 1 Noah Davis 2023-11-27 04:39:59 UTC
> While we're at it, we could also improve the date/time formatting with dashes and colons. It is not very easily readable right now.

I agree, but for the sake of organization, that should be in a separate report.
Comment 2 Bug Janitor Service 2023-11-28 08:40:01 UTC
A possibly relevant merge request was started @ https://invent.kde.org/graphics/spectacle/-/merge_requests/297
Comment 3 Bug Janitor Service 2023-11-28 20:38:38 UTC
A possibly relevant merge request was started @ https://invent.kde.org/graphics/spectacle/-/merge_requests/299
Comment 4 Noah Davis 2023-11-28 20:39:36 UTC
Git commit b889a9474060ce46c07edca81bf09189ab00f690 by Noah Davis.
Committed on 28/11/2023 at 21:37.
Pushed by ndavis into branch 'master'.

Localize default filename template settings

M  +7    -0    kconf_update/CMakeLists.txt
A  +33   -0    kconf_update/spectacle-24.02.0-keep_old_filename_templates.cpp     [License: LGPL(v2.0+)]
M  +4    -0    kconf_update/spectacle.upd
M  +8    -2    src/Gui/SettingsDialog/spectacle.kcfg

https://invent.kde.org/graphics/spectacle/-/commit/b889a9474060ce46c07edca81bf09189ab00f690